Etymology

[edit]

Borrowed from Ancient Greek Μαραθών (Marathṓn, Marathon, a town northeast of Athens).

Noun

[edit]

марато́н (maratónm

  1. (athletics) marathon (42.195-kilometre road race)
  2. (figuratively) marathon (any extended or sustained activity)
